- Brief description:
- A newspaper cutting containing a poem written by Charles Thomas Capper. The poem was written to coincide with the unveiling of the Port Sunlight War Memorial, and would have been published c1921-22. A note sent with the poem states that Charles Thomas Capper lived at 5 Boundary Road Port Sunlight.
